PROFESSOR OF JAZZ PIANO - RCM

Mike Moran is one of the United Kingdom’s best known musicians.   As a Keyboard Player, Arranger, Musical Director and Producer, he has worked with many of the world’s superstars including, Sir Paul McCartney, Stevie Wonder, Paul Simon, George Harrison, Robert Plant, Sir Cliff Richard, Julio Iglesias, Placido Domingo, Jose Carreras, Dionne Warwick, Ashford and Simpson, Kate Bush, Montserrat Caballe, Ozzy Osbourne, Oliver Nelson, Jack Jones, Wayne Shorter, Ringo Starr, Carly Simon, Dusty Springfield, Gadys Knight, Sir Rod Stewart, George Michael, Extreme, Joe Cocker, Lemar and Queen with the late Freddie Mercury and their major collaboration was the Album Barcelona which Sir Tim Rice co-wrote lyrics on three tracks. Bands include Blue Mink, Stone The Crows (later the Maggie Bell Band) and Gillian.  Other live engagements have been as Piano/Musical Director and Conductor to Leo Sayer, Lulu, Elaine Paige, Russell Watson, Sir Rod Stewart.  As a movie composer, Mike wrote and orchestrated a number of movies for George Harrison’s company Handmade Films including the cult film Time Bandits directed by Terry Gilliam, The Missionaryand Water. Other film credits include Deathwish 3, The Bitch, The Greek Tycoon, Top Secret, Betrayal, Whoops Apocalypse, Sherlock and A Fox Tale.  He has composed original music for over 200, networked T.V. productions including The Simpsons, Harry’s Game, Taggart, Sharman, Sex Chips and Rock n’ Roll, New Tricks El Cid, Beebies.  Documentaries include This England and Never and Always for Denis Mitchell, Colossus for Jacques Cousteau.  In Musical theatre, Mike’s credits include Production Musical Director on the  rock musical Time, Dominion Theatre staring Sir Cliff Richard and Sir Laurence Olivier and also worked with Sir Cliff Richard on Heathcliff.  Mike Produced the London cast album of The King & I for Warner Records and also Piaf which both starred Elaine Paige, August 2009.  He also worked as Musical Director to Denise Van Outen on Blondes at the Edinburgh festival in 2009then as Music Supervisor on Stratford East5 Guyswhich won best musical award in 2009 Edinburgh Festival.  Mike was also Musical Director for Sir Rod Stewart’s, One Night With Rod Stewart at the Royal Albert Hall and he has recently completed two World Tours as Musical Director/Conductor and pianist for Russell Watson and Elaine Paige.  Mike’s conducting credits include concerts and recordings with The London Symphony OrchestraThe Royal Philharmonic OrchestraThe BBC Concert Orchestra, The Utah Symphony Orchestra, The Tokyo Philharmonic, The Sydney Symphony Orchestra, The Adelaide Symphony Orchestra, The Wellington Symphoniaand The Budapest Philharmonic.
